> It is impossible to reproject from a simple XY location to a > projected location, or vice versa. Simple XY is just like graph > paper, with no Earth-based geo-* part to it. It is most commonly > used for imagery where x,y are measured in pixels, and manual geo- > referencing must be performed, not a reprojection between known > coord systems. > Yes, I hadn't noticed this xy. Sure it won't work. > > Start over from the beginning, creating a new lat/lon location and > importing your data into it.
